-1

重複の可能性:
PHP によって既に送信されたヘッダー

オープンソース愛好家にあいさつ。

以下に貼り付けられたエラーが何を意味するのか、誰か説明してください。セッション変数を保存し、header("Location:home.php"); を使用してユーザーをホームページにリダイレクトした直後に、エラーに遭遇しました。関数。どんな助けでも大歓迎です。

Warning: Cannot modify header information - headers already sent by 
    (output started at C:\xampp\htdocs\testproject\login.php:58) 
    in C:\xampp\htdocs\testproject\inc\checklogin.php on line 35
4

2 に答える 2

-1

あなたが提供したエラーから、login.phpスクリプトにchecklogin.phpを含めたかrequire_oncedしたと思います。それが、phpがそのエラーを出す理由です。ログインシステムでは、実際にそれを行う必要はありません。ユーザーをログインからチェックログインにリダイレクトし、ログインが正しい場合はホームにリダイレクトし、ログインが正しくない場合はログインにリダイレクトします..

于 2012-09-06T14:11:10.693 に答える